| Hyperprolactinemia (HPRL) are a group of syndrome caused by many reasons resulted in reducing of prolactin (PRL) levels. The clinical performance contained galactorrhea, amenorrhea, menstrual scarce, fat, infertility, anovulation[1]. Now the main treatment drugs are ergot alkaloids, such as bromocriptine. However such drugs have many side effects and are more expensive, so patients have the poor compliance. Malt is a kind of Chinese medicine commonly use in clinical, have the effects such as digestion, appetizer, swelling and so on. The compound Chinese medicines are commonly used in treating HPRL, and the pre-clinical observation of single malt has show a satisfactory effect in treating this disease. So we make further studies on the treatment of malt in HPRL to confirm the active site and active constituent in treating this disease. And then develop the traditional Chinese drugs into a new Chinese drugs pharmaceutics that have exact effect and low-price, change the situation of depend on bromocriptine that is the major expensive importing drug to treat HPRL.The effect of total malt extract on PRL level in the female HPRL mice:Inducing the female HPRL mice model by metoclopramide, that is dopamine receptor antagonist drugs[2], using bromocriptine as the control, giving the high, medium and low-dose malt extract treatment, detecting the blood serum PRL of by radioimmunoassay, analyzing its results with statistical software. The results showed the blood serum PRL of the high, medium and low-dose total malt extract group were significantly decreased, the difference was significant (P<0.05), the total malt extract could inhibit HPRL induced by metoclopramide, the effect is similar to the role of bromocriptine. And determining the polysaccharide content of malt extract by the phenol-sulfuric acid method, determining the flavonoids content of malt extract by UV spectrophotometer.The effect of basic constituent malt extract on PRL levels in the female HPRL mice:The method is same as the part of 1. The results showed the blood serum PRL of the high, medium and low-dose basic constituents malt extract group were significantly decreased, the difference was significant (P<0.05). it is evidenced that the active constituent of inhibiting HPRL may be the basic constituent malt extract.Piper wallichii was a perennial herb of the genus piper, which belong to the family piperaceae. This plant was used for promoting blood circulation, alleviating pain, improving sexual function and the treatment of beriberoid disease[3]. In this study, the phamacognostic methods were applied, the extract of Piper wallichii was examined, moisture and ash were detemined, and the bioactive constituents of piperlonguminine were analyzed by TLC and HPLC. The established method can be used for the quality control of Piper wallichii. To provide scientific basis for the utilization and development of this herb and lay the foundation in developing new drugs.In our study, aristololactams, including Cepharanone B, Aristolactam Aâ…¡and Aristololatams Aâ…¢a, are seperated for the first time from piperaceae and have the renal toxicity[4]. So it is essential to determine the content of these constituents. At equal condition, the contents of three aristololactams were simultaneously determined in Piper wallichii by HPLC-UV, which could fully help to improve the quality control of this herb and would provide an important reference to establish the quality control method for other related traditional Chinese medicines preparations. Furthermore, the established method laid the substance foundation for toxicity studies. |
